People need from under one liter a day to nearly four liters a day depending on their age, sex and health status. One liter equals 4.23 cups. Newborns and infants need 0.7 to 0.8 liters of water a day from breast milk or formula. Toddlers need 1.3 liters and young children up to eight years need 1.7 liters daily.

Pregnant women … WebU.S. survey data show that drinking water and other beverages provide about 81% of total water consumed by 19- to 30-year old men and women. Food provides the remainder, about 20% of total water intake. The high water content of many fruits and vegetables gives yet another good reason to include them in our diets.
